Alright, Amoreena thanks for taking the time to share your stories and insights with us today. When you were first starting out, did you join a firm or start your own?
Jumping into real estate from being a psychotherapist for years was a rather exciting experience and a risky experience for me. I started studying for my exam right before the pandemic in January 2020, it was something I had been considering for years since my parents team had done rather well locally. I made the choice to join their team with Pacific Sotheby’s International as soon as I finished my real estate courses and exam. The brand recognition of Pacific Sotheby’s is definitely one that is instantly known in the industry and respected. As a new agent to me this was a critical component to my success. The firm has some of the most talented professionals that have high standards which again aligned with who I am and who I want to be as an agent. I was also impressed with the international networks and global media partnerships which would elevate my marketing opportunities. I did enter real estate at a rather challenging time with little inventory, no open houses and had to navigate the trials and tribulations of Covid19. While all of this has had some hurdles I consider my first year with over 5.5mil in sales to me a success!

Can you tell us about what’s worked well for you in terms of growing your clientele?
At the end of the day everyone knows someone who is a real estate agent, but for me the best way to grow clientele is to be authentic and to show value. Being honest and trustworthy I believe is one of the most important things in real estate. My job isn’t just to sell someone a house, that is easy, my job is really to sell you a lifestyle you want. It is to help guide you through one of the most difficult financial decisions you will make in the next 3-5 years. That process alone is emotional and stressful for most people and if you don’t have a relationship with your agent or you don’t trust them to guide you in the right direction than it can be a disaster. So currently I work on building my relationships in my community and building trust with others as a knowledgeable real estate agent.
What’s worked well for you in terms of a source for new clients?
The best source of clients for me has been word of mouth and my network. I am grateful for my friends and family to trust me in their real estate transactions and hope to continue to grow my business.
